@mba-help said:Raghav, there has to be reason for doing a masters in finance - don't think of it just because you do not have any job at this time. I would suggest you to look at the FT rankings for Masters in Finance programs- browse through the websites of these programs. Look at the student profiles, the academics, the extra curricular activities, recruitment figures and determine for yourself whether this a Masters in Finance is what you want. Essentially, are you cut out for a career in hardcore finance?Namita, MBA Decoder

Hi,
I think your work experience is at the lower side right now and you should wait 2-3 years before you apply. My reasons are:
1. I assume you would not have got many achievements at work, considering your short tenure. Early career applicants would typically have stellar academic records and extra curricular achievements at college. Your GPA scores are average and the CA though helpful is not considered an academic credential.
2. As you did not go to a regular college for BCom, I assume you did not get many chances to grow your profile on the extra curricular front.
Building a good work profile will help you mitigate these pitfalls to an extent and make your journey to an MBA a lot more easier.
Namita, MBA Decoder
